Popular Foods in Le Val

Rillettes de Porc

A type of pork spread that is made from slow-cooked pork belly or shoulder that is shredded and preserved in its own fat, popular in the Loire region.

Tarte Tatin

A traditional French dessert made from apples caramelized in butter and sugar, then baked under a pastry crust and flipped before serving.

Beurre Blanc

A classic butter sauce originating from the Loire Valley, made with butter, shallots, and vinegar or white wine, typically served with seafood dishes.

Moules marinières

A simple yet flavorful dish of mussels cooked with white wine, shallots, and parsley, popular in the coastal areas of the Loire region.

Sainte-Maure de Touraine

A type of goat cheese that is ash-coated and has a signature log shape with a straw through its center, from the Loire region.

Custom Language

Faire la bise

Air kiss greeting

A common greeting involving cheek-to-cheek air kisses, signifying friendly interaction and social closeness.

P'tit déj

Breakfast

A casual way to refer to breakfast, commonly used in conversations about morning meals.

Je suis crevé

I'm exhausted

An expression to convey extreme tiredness, often used after a long day or strenuous activity.

Ça marche

Okay, works

An informal way to agree with someone, equivalent to saying OK or That works.

Avoir la frite

Feeling great

A colloquial saying meaning to be in good shape or high spirits. It's often used to describe someone's good mood or energy.

Unique customs/traditions

The Cidre Festival

An annual celebration in the region celebrating apple harvest where locals produce Cidre, the traditional apple cider. It's marked by festivities including tastings, music, and dancing.

La Foire de Craon

A traditional fair held in Craon, featuring agricultural exhibitions, local food stalls, and funfair activities. It is a significant cultural event in the Pays de la Loire region.

Le Pardon de Saint Anne

A traditional Catholic festival where locals make a pilgrimage to honor Saint Anne. This includes processions, Mass, and communal meals.

The Vendée Globe

A world-renowned sailing race starting in Les Sables-d'Olonne. It's a non-stop solo circumnavigation, one of the most challenging maritime events that attracts significant local participation and viewership.

Translayon Music Festival

A local music festival promoting traditional and contemporary music acts. It's an occasion for the community to come together and celebrate cultural diversity through music.
